Iron deficiency anemia is a microcytic anemia that occurs when loss of iron exceeds intake. Iron deficiency anemia (ida) is the most common form of anemia worldwide and is caused by inadequate intake, decreased absorption (e.g., atrophic gastritis, inflammatory bowel disease),. Once absorbed, it is sequestered in ferritin if body stores are adequate. In the blood, iron may be free (black circle), or bound to transferrin (red doughnut). The average adult stores about 1 to 3 grams of iron in his or her body. Iron is absorbed in divalent form by enterocytes via the divalent metal transporter (dmt1).
